About the Role
We are working with a leading commercial law firm to hire a Risk Lawyer. In this role, you will join a growing, highly collaborative team of experts to deliver a comprehensive legal risk and regulatory compliance service across all practice groups and business operations.
The firm is looking for a qualified solicitor or barrister in England & Wales with a current practicing certificate and a strong track record in law firm risk management. We would like to hear from candidates who possess a deep familiarity with common law, UCTA, and the principles of professional negligence. You should have an awareness of the Solicitors Accounts Rules and a calm, commercially aware approach that allows you to deliver complex legal risk messages confidently.
The responsibilities will include:
- Providing expert legal and regulatory advice to fee earners, business support functions, and senior management on the SRA Standards and Regulations, ethical boundaries, and complex conflicts of interest.
- Advising on high-stakes financial crime and regulatory frameworks, including POCA, anti-money laundering, the Bribery Act, Market Abuse Regulations, and ECCTA.
- Managing data protection governance, including evaluating data breaches and coordinating responses to Data Subject Access Requests under GDPR.
- Reviewing, drafting, and negotiating bespoke client retainers, outside counsel guidelines, panel terms, and supplier agreements, with a strong focus on limitations of liability.
- Advising legal teams on potential professional indemnity claims or circumstances, reporting matters to insurers, and managing responses to first-tier client and third-party complaints.
- Designing, updating, and implementing robust firm-wide compliance policies, risk procedures, and internal audit programmes.
- Developing and delivering comprehensive compliance training and inductions to partners, fee earners, and staff at all levels of seniority.
- Assisting with major annual compliance cycles, including the firm’s professional indemnity insurance renewal, SRA bulk practicing certificate renewal (RF1), and statutory registrations.
- Supporting the firm through external compliance assessments, including annual ISO audits (9001, 27001, 22301, 14001) and Cyber Essentials Plus recertifications.
